Explanation
Intrinsic motivation is the internal drive that comes from enjoyment, curiosity, satisfaction, and personal engagement rather than external rewards like money or recognition. Activities driven by intrinsic motivation are sustainable and fulfilling. For PKM to be effective long-term, it should tap into intrinsic motivation - genuine curiosity, the joy of learning, and the satisfaction of creating connections. Understanding your intrinsic motivators helps design systems you'll actually use.
